Search

Best Juice shop in Ewa Beach, HI

Showing 1-1 of 1 results


Jamba
94-1401 Fort Weaver Rd, Ewa Beach, HI
4.0

(75+ Reviews)

© 2025 Checkle, Inc

Privacy

Terms